About Jalepeno chips

Jalapeño Chips offer a bold and spicy twist on traditional potato chips, blending crispy texture with the fiery flavor of jalapeño peppers. Made primarily from thinly sliced potatoes, they are fried or baked to achieve their signature crunch, then seasoned with a mix of jalapeño powder, chili spices, and often a touch of salt. Popular in Tex-Mex and Southwestern cuisines, these chips are a favorite for those seeking a snack with a kick. While they provide energy via carbohydrates and fats, they tend to be high in sodium and may contain trans fats depending on preparation. Some brands offer baked varieties, which lower fat content slightly. Though not a significant source of nutrients, they can be enjoyed in moderation as a flavorful treat.
